Fire ban still active

Thursday, May 7, 2026 · Langdon, AB

Rocky View County's fire ban remains an important safety update for Langdon this week. Burn barrels, wood burning fires, and fireworks permits are suspended, while approved gas barbecues, camp stoves, pellet grills, and propane or natural gas fire pits may still be used with care. With dry spring conditions continuing, this is a good time for households to double check outdoor plans and keep fire safety top of mind.
